    I've always viewed it as their exhaustion album, where they were too tired of being in Beatlemania. So they jam through some covers, but then the originals take a BIG step forward. Lennon responds to the exhaustion with misery ("I'm a Loser", "No Reply" and "I Don't Want to Spoil the Party") and McCartney smiles through it ("I'll Follow the Sun"). In a way, it kind of set the precedent for who The Beatles were.
